Postsecondary Planning Milestones Toolkit

NYC Department of Education’s Postsecondary Planning Milestones Toolkit provides effective and actionable strategies. One is a 9-12 interactive postsecondary planning checklist that has lesson plans for teachers and advisors and helps students and families make meaningful traction towards postsecondary milestones.

K-12 College and Career Readiness Calendar

This 15-Month College & Career Readiness Calendar for High Schools from the National College Attainment Network is interactive and has comprehensive categories, action items and resources. Filter for “Early Awareness” to see elementary and middle school activities and suggestions, many of which can happen virtually and are also great community builders.

Oakland Unified School District Data Dashboard

Oakland Unified School District uses these data dashboards combining 8th grade indicators along with other postsecondary readiness indicators to help proactively identify students with more needs and ideally set them up for more supports. Start or Expand a School Breakfast Program

Check out this guide from Child Nutrition Outreach Program (CNOP) on how to start or expand a breakfast program across your school or district. The guide includes ways to create a grab and go breakfast or a more traditional program.
